Audi A7 Sportback: Prototype drive report

Audi A7 Sportback
Very nice and interesting drive report here with the prototype of the Audi A7.
To set the mood, Audi let us drive the A7 Sportback concept in the Los Angeles area. It was first shown at this year's Detroit auto show and is as close as you can get to the A7 production car. The changes to the exterior will be minimal: Audi will come up with an even more angular front, replacing the overwrought lower air intakes of the concept. The rear panel also will be slightly more upright and the car will stand less than half an inch taller. That's it.

Rather than second-guessing well-established categories and the fluid lines of the past, Audi's designers have come up with a stunningly graceful fastback—in the spirit of the more futuristic executive sedans of the 1970s. Its shape renders the A7 a direct competitor of the Mercedes-Benz CLS.
